HE08654: THE WIRES CONTAINED INTO A WIREGROUP ARE NOT TAKEN INTO ACCOUNT FOR THE GEOMETRICAL BUNDLE INERTIA CALCULATION

Error description

  • Problem Scenario (Step by Step):
    1. Set French as Regional Language in the Windows settings
    (the comma must be the decimal separator)
    2. Start CATIA V5
    3. Open the file " ENSEMBLE.CATProduct ".
    4. Activate the workshop "Equipements & Systems > Electrical
    Harness Discipline > Electrical Wire Routing .
    5. Create the electric harness with "Harness g←om←trique1" as
    reference.
    6. Use the function " Select external systems " and choose
    "H200_Fils" as current system.
    7. Use the command " automatic Routing of the wires ": Select
    all the wires " as 'wire / group ofwires to forward " and
    click on "route".
    Result: The report of routing is in accordance and all is
    correct.
    8. Execute the update.
    9. Activate the workshop " Equipments and Systems >
    Electrical Harness Discipline > Electrical Harness Assembly
    ".
    10. Execute the command " Measure geometrical bundle inertia
    " and select " Harness ←lectrique1 " (Electrical Bundle1).
    Result: a section "Paremeters" containing "Equivalent_xxx",
    appears in the geometrical harness (cf. image_002).
    11. Execute the command " Measure inertia " and select the
    product root " Product2 ".
    Result: The result is correct. The mass of the harness
    corresponds well to the wires + connectors ( image_003 ):
    0,456kg
    12. Close the product
    13. Repeat the steps 3. to 11, replacing H200_fils by
    H200_Cable at the point 6.
    Note that in the point 7, it is not possible to select only
    the wires as the objects to be forwarded. Only the selection
    of the group of wires is possible.
    ERROR: In the point 10, note that the setting
    Equivalent_masse is 0 ( image_004 ). The measures of the COG
    and the mass does not display.
    The mass of the wires is not taken into account in the
    inertia measure (image_005).
    Expected behavior: the mass of the routed wires should be
    taken into account, either they are in a wiregroup or not.

Problem conclusion

  • THIS PROBLEM WILL BE FIXED ON Virtual Design  VERSION V5R22
    GA level.
    NOTE THAT THIS PROBLEM WILL ALSO BE FIXED ON V5R20 SP7.
    NOTE THAT THIS PROBLEM WILL ALSO BE FIXED ON V5R21 SP2.
    Additional Closure Information:
    Technical explanation of the defect:
    Wires inside a Wire Group were not taken into consideration
    while calculating GBN inertia.
    Technical explanation of the correction:
    While calculating Mass and CoG of the GBN, only wires were
    taken into consideration. Added code to take into
    consideration all the Wires (including wires inside the Wire
    Groups) for calculating the mass.
